关于基本力量发展的体力炼和心理物理学习

Gaetano Raiola1, Giovanni Esposito1, Sara Aliberti1

  • 1Research Centre of Physical Education and Exercise, Pegaso University, 80143 Napoli, Italy.

Methods and protocols
|April 25, 2025
PubMed
概括
此摘要是机器生成的。

力量训练可以提高身体表现,增加运动动机. 这项研究表明,强度的提高与对炼益处的更大认识相关,突出了其对坚持炼的教育潜力.

科学领域:

  • 运动生理学 运动生理学
  • 运动科学 运动科学 运动科学
  • 行为科学 行为科学

背景情况:

  • 力量的发展增强神经调节,神经连接和运动单元的效率.
  • 个人感知和知识对于优化炼参与度至关重要,但与增强强度相比,研究不足.
  • 现有的研究缺乏对力量发展与心理因素之间的关系的全面研究.

研究的目的:

  • 调查力量训练效率与个人的感知,意见和知识之间的关联.
  • 建立性能提升与对运动生理要求的意识之间的联系.
  • 探索体育炼在促进心理健康方面的教育潜力.

主要方法:

  • 24名久坐不动的成年人 (35-55岁) 接受了一项力量培养方案.
  • 在研究期间,基于感知的问卷以三次间隔进行.
  • 统计分析包括重复测量ANOVA和弗里德曼测试.

主要成果:

  • 观察到手握测试强度 (p < 0.01) 的显著改善.
  • 参与者报告说,运动动机增加了35%,久坐行为减少了42%.
  • 78%的人表现出对运动益处的认识增加,与身体改善有积极的相关性.

结论:

  • 增强力量与提高对体力炼益处的认识有关.
  • 运动可以作为一种教育工具,以提高参与度和坚持度.
  • 将心理评估与体育训练相结合,可以优化炼方案.
